Player: Cole Koeninger
School: Keller (TX)Position(s): SS/RHP
Height: 6’3″Weight: 215 lbs.Bats: RightThrows: Right
Summary:
Koeninger embodies the definition of a two-way phenom — a premium athlete with lightning in both his bat and his arm. At the plate, he shows elite bat speed and the ability to drive the ball with authority to all fields. His hands work quick and short through the zone, producing violent but balanced contact that translates into legitimate in-game power. There’s some swing-and-miss baked in due to his aggression, but the bat speed, strength, and pitch recognition continue to tighten, giving him a chance to be a true middle-of-the-order threat. Defensively, the actions are electric: fluid feet, fast transfers, and a plus arm that easily plays from the left side of the infield.

On the mound, Koeninger brings the same explosiveness. The fastball sits comfortably in the mid-90s and has reached 98 with arm-side run and life through the zone. He mixes two distinct breaking balls — a sharper, bullet-shaped slider in the low-80s and a 12–6 curveball with real bite that flashes plus — while the changeup rounds out a full starter’s mix. The delivery is short and quick from a slightly closed setup, producing deception and carry despite the effort in the finish. When he’s synced up, the arsenal overwhelms hitters from either side of the plate.

The total package is one of the loudest in the class: a legitimate shortstop with plus power potential and a frontline-quality arm capable of reaching the upper-90s. Whether his long-term home is on the mound or in the box, Koeninger’s combination of athleticism, intensity, and elite tools gives him top-five overall upside and the makings of a cornerstone talent.
